全球核酸治療市場預計將在 2023 年達到 59 億美元,並從 2024 年的 67 億美元成長到 2032 年的 185.9 億美元,預測期內(2025-2032 年)的複合年成長率為 13.6%。

隨著人們對癌症、癲癇、糖尿病、結核病和愛滋病等慢性疾病的創新治療興趣日益濃厚,核酸治療市場可望快速成長。核酸,包括 DNA、RNA 和合成變體,對於向細胞傳遞基本訊息至關重要,並因其重要的治療應用而受到認可。隨著多種新治療方法的核准和強勁的開發平臺,市場正在蓬勃發展,這得益於製藥和醫療保健領域的進步,尤其是生物製藥和 DNA 療法領域的進步。隨著對有效慢性病治療的需求不斷成長,這為相關人員提供了充滿希望的機會,使基於核酸的解決方案處於現代醫學的前沿。

Global Nucleic Acid Therapeutics Market size was valued at USD 5.9 billion in 2023 and is poised to grow from USD 6.7 billion in 2024 to USD 18.59 billion by 2032, growing at a CAGR of 13.6% during the forecast period (2025-2032).

The nucleic acid therapeutics market is poised for rapid growth, driven by increased interest in innovative treatments for chronic diseases, including cancer, epilepsy, diabetes, tuberculosis, and AIDS. Nucleic acids, encompassing DNA, RNA, and synthetic variants, are pivotal in conveying essential cellular information and are recognized for their critical therapeutic applications. With multiple new therapies gaining approval and a robust pipeline of developments, the market is experiencing an upswing, fueled by advancements in the pharmaceutical and healthcare sectors, particularly within biopharmaceuticals and DNA therapeutics. This landscape showcases a promising opportunity for stakeholders as the demand for effective chronic disease treatments continues to escalate, positioning nucleic acid-based solutions at the forefront of modern medicine.

Driver of the Global Nucleic Acid Therapeutics Market

The Global Nucleic Acid Therapeutics market is significantly driven by the rapid advancements in molecular technologies and the extensive research in the field of omics. This evolving landscape has prompted numerous companies to intensify their investments as they strive to enhance their competitive edge. As the market evolves, various business strategies, such as acquisitions, partnerships, and collaborations, play a crucial role in capturing market share and generating revenue. A notable example is Merck & Co.'s announcement in August 2022 regarding a collaborative effort with Orna Therapeutics aimed at discovering, developing, and commercializing innovative RNA-based therapies targeting vaccines, infectious diseases, and oncology.

Restraints in the Global Nucleic Acid Therapeutics Market

The Global Nucleic Acid Therapeutics market faces significant restraints, notably in the area of delivery challenges. A primary obstacle is the effective transport of nucleic acid therapies to their intended target cells, as achieving precise localization while minimizing off-target effects is complex. The intricate nature of nucleic acid compounds often complicates their integration into existing biological systems, leading to potential inefficacies in treatment outcomes. As a result, overcoming these delivery-related issues is crucial for the market's growth, necessitating ongoing research and innovative solutions to enhance the precision and effectiveness of these therapeutic agents in clinical applications.

Market Trends of the Global Nucleic Acid Therapeutics Market

The Global Nucleic Acid Therapeutics market is experiencing significant growth, fueled by heightened investments in healthcare services and a growing focus on advanced treatment methodologies. As the prevalence of genetic disorders and chronic illnesses rises, research and development efforts are intensifying, leading to innovative therapeutic solutions leveraging nucleic acids, such as RNA-based therapies and gene editing techniques. This surge in investment is not only accelerating the pace of research but also enhancing health facility capabilities, thereby expanding market opportunities. Additionally, increased collaboration between public and private sectors is facilitating breakthroughs in treatment, positioning nucleic acid therapeutics as a cornerstone in modern medical care.
